This section of the v0.3 design is still accurate:

http://freeorion.org/index.php/V.3_Requ ... rce_Meters

Quote:
Focus settings have these effects on max meter values:

* Primary Focus adds + 15 to the selected Max Meter
* Primary Balanced Focus adds +3 to all Max Resource Meters.
* Secondary Specialized Focus adds +5 to the selected Max Meter
* Secondary Balanced Focus adds +1 to all Max Resource Meters.

Some technologies and buildings effectively increase the bonus applied by Primary Focus. See Effects for details.

These "Basic Focus and Universe" meter contributions are set by the values in a data table:

http://freeorion.svn.sourceforge.net/vi ... iew=markup

Tech, building, special, ship part or hull effects may also add or subtract from max meter values, depending on focus settings.
